Death10 February 2011Wayne Joseph Faber died on 10 February 2011 at age 84 Wayne J. Faber, age 84, of Richland Center, passed away on Thursday, Feb. 10, 2011, at the Richland Hospital. He was born on May 12, 1926, the son of Joseph and Marie (Wiedenfeld) Faber. He was married on Oct. 22, 1947, to the former Marcella Brickl. Wayne was a member of St. Mary's Catholic Church in Richland Center. He was a dairy farmer for 50 years and Bear Creek Town Chairman for 16 years. He taught CCD, was on the parish council and in the choir for many years at St. Mary's Catholic Church in Keyesville and at St. Patrick's Catholic Church in Loreto. Wayne was a well known musician for 40 years starting at the age of 14 with the Faber Family Band then the Ederer Brothers Band and several other bands. He played the accordion for many weddings and barn dances and his signature song was "The Auctioneer." Death7 August 2005Robin C. Squires Sr. died on 7 August 2005 at age 74 Robin C. Squires Sr., age 74, died on Sunday, Aug. 7, 2005, in a local care center. He was born on Feb. 24, 1931, in Sauk City, the son of Delbert and Olive (Crary) Squires. Prior to his retirement in 1990, Robin had been employed by the City of Madison Parks Department for 36 years. He served in the United States Army during the Korean Conflict and was a member of V.F.W. Post No. 8483. On May 5, 1951, Robin was united in marriage with Delores Parks in Jeffersonville, Ind.
